			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ynet is now advocating rent control (<a href="http://www.ynet.co.il/articles/0,7340,L-3975184,00.html">here</a>, Hebrew).  Citing similar practices in Europe and New York, it derides the idea that this is Bolshevism, and support a bill before the Knesset that would increase governmental pricing <a href="http://www.ynetnews.com/articles/0,7340,L-3950923,00.html">control</a>.  The relationship between communist ideology and government control over private property aside, the writer set forth what appears to be a long and detailed argument.  Appearances, however, are deceiving.  One particularly ridiculous argument caught my eye; the writer found it funny to associate rent control with communism, because in the Soviet Union, the state owned all property and property rentals did not exist.  Basic finances allude the writer, because if your wages are set by your landlord&#8211;clearly you&#8217;re paying rent, as determined by the state-landlord.</p>
<p>As for the substance of the piece, the writer confuses two concepts: pricing-control and regulation of discrimination.  &#8220;In the United States and Europe it is forbidden to refuse to rent because the tenants are homosexuals, immigrants, or even a family with children.&#8221;  I do not know much about European law, but this statement of the law in the United States is misleading, at best.  For one, there is no such thing as a single body of &#8220;American law,&#8221; especially when it comes to real property.  Property law is largely regulated at the municipal level (not to mention distinctions between federal and state laws).  Yet, addressing only federal law: (1) <a href="http://gaylife.about.com/od/housingdiscrimination/a/realestate.htm">in most states</a>, homosexuals are not a <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Protected_class">protected class</a>; (2) in fact, the <a href="http://www.law.cornell.edu/uscode/html/uscode42/usc_sec_42_00003603----000-.html">Fair Housing Act</a> does allow one to discriminate in many ways, when it comes to choosing tenants (see &#8216;exemptions&#8217;).</p>
<p>Nevertheless, the result of such government intervention has been predicted, analyzed, and ignored long ago.  As Richard Posner, <a href="http://scholar.google.com/scholar_case?case=17932228216878041574">has described</a>, <a href="http://www.econlib.org/library/Enc/RentControl.html">among others</a>, rent control leads to a contraction in the housing market, because more people will decide that selling their property is a better financial move  (&#8220;if price is artificially depressed, or the costs of landlords artificially increased, supply falls and many tenants, usually the poorer and the newer tenants, are hurt&#8221;).  The smaller number of rented apartments will be substandard, as it will not be in landlords&#8217; financial interest to spend more than the minimum to maintain their apartments.</p>
<p>Ultimately, those who will be hurt will be the poor&#8211;not the evil wealthy.  As described, there will be fewer low-cost apartments on the market, and those will be maintained even more poorly than they are now.  Rent control will &#8220;reduce the resources that landlords devote to improving the quality of housing, by making the provision of rental housing more costly.&#8221; (Posner)  The contraction in the rental market will lead to an increase in the supply of units for sale.  The resulting decrease in purchase price will benefit the middle class, and the poor will be worse off than they are now.  Another potential result is that wealthier tenants, who do not wish to buy, will opt out of governmental price-control, thus allowing them to benefit from a higher level of services&#8211;paid for accordingly.</p>
<p>The bottom line is that the ynet writer does not know the first thing about price control.  Then again, the negative impact of such a move are unlikely to have a negative effect on her directly.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A recent bill proposal is being promoted by Netanyahu, and would drastically alter the status of lands in Israel. The legal status of land in Israel is not simple matter. In a nutshell, 93% of the land in Israel is <a href="http://www.palestinefacts.org/pf_1991to_now_israel_land.php">not privately owned</a> (owned either by the state or JNF), but is leased by the state for 49-year leases. Administered by the Israel Land Administration (ILA), these leases are renewed nearly automatically.</p>
<p>Proponents of the bill say the ILA is a monopolistic, <a href="http://occidentalisraeli.com/2009/05/23/existential-threats-corruption/">ineffective bureaucracy</a> and hampers economic growth. Privatization, they claim, will make housing more affordable and promote overall transparency with regards to land use.</p>
<div id="attachment_1906"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 282px"><a href="http://www.flickr.com/photos/zeevveez/2557811425/"><img class="size-full wp-image-1906 " title="JNF" src="http://occidentalisraeli.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/07/jnf.jpg" alt="by zeevveez" width="272" height="297" /></a><p class="wp-caption-text">by zeevveez</p></div>
<p><a href="http://muqata.blogspot.com/2009/07/and-land-shall-not-be-sold-in.html">Critics</a>, on the other hand, say that housing costs will actually rise. The most convincing argument against the proposed bill is a Zionist-ideological one. If land is simply sold to the highest bidder, Israeli law would allow enemies of Israel to purchase large swaths of Israel, essentially buying out Israel from under her.</p>
<p>As anyone who has had the misfortune of applying for an Israeli passport knows, Israeli bureaucracy is not customer friendly, to put it lightly. Reform is necessary, and in that respect Netanyahu&#8217;s plan is not all bad. However, the current bill, if approved, would cause a great deal of long-term harm to Israel.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Israel is in the Middle East. The Middle East is largely an <a href="http://occidentalisraeli.com/2009/01/03/operation-cast-lead-arab-world-i/">Arabophone region</a>. These two facts are undisputed. However, Israel insists on behaving like a western outpost in the Orient. While it does so with regards to its foreign policy, it is equally true, and just as foolhardy, with regards to domestic issues.</p>
<p>While many Israelis would like to be European <a href="http://occidentalisraeli.com/2009/05/16/new-york-yordim/">or American</a>, they are not. Modern Israeli culture and behavior is <a href="http://talkingloud.sayingnothing.com/2009/04/18/baptism-by-traffic-accident/">derived from numerous sources</a>, and has morphed into something new.</p>
<p>The current level of language instruction in Israel has a lot of room for improvement. Though not as bad as English, <a href="http://occidentalisraeli.com/2009/06/26/importance-hebrew/">Hebrew language</a> instruction in Israel is poor, to say the least. Instead of improving, Israel&#8217;s Ministry of Education <a href="http://www.haaretz.com/hasen/spages/945899.html">has decided</a> that regional language skills are unimportant. As of last year, Arabic has been completely dropped from the mandatory core curriculum.</p>
<p>This was not in order to invest more in to Hebrew or English instruction. There was no pedagogical reason for this decision. This step down in Israeli education was “motivated by an effort to create a curriculum acceptable to ultra-Orthodox schools.” This capitulation to <a href="http://occidentalisraeli.com/2009/06/30/proshabbat-antistate/">narrow political interests</a> is corruption, pure and simple.</p>
<p>Things are <a href="http://www.nytimes.com/2009/06/20/nyregion/20metjournal.html">different</a> <a href="http://www.forward.com/articles/105957/">on the other side of the ocean</a>. Instead of imparting the language of the Jewish people to the next generation, some Jewish day schools are expanding their language departments to include Arabic.</p>
<p>This is the right move in the wrong place. I am not saying Jewish students should not learn Arabic. They should &#8211; in Israel. The problem is prioritization. Adding another language to the mix will only serve to dilute the already lacking Hebrew instruction offered by the Jewish educational system in America. In other words, first Hebrew, and only then Arabic.</p>
<p>Israeli education needs to strive for nothing less than excellence. Excellence in today&#8217;s Middle East requires the knowledge of Arabic. Instead of eliminating three years of Arabic study from the curriculum, language instruction in Israel needs to be placed front and center. Along with Hebrew and English, students should begin Arabic studies in first grade, if not beforehand.</p>
<p>I am in no way advocating forgoing Hebrew in favor of Arabic. Nor do I think Arabic is more important than English. The three languages are not mutually exclusive. Nevertheless, understanding, and playing by “house rules” in the Middle East requires knowing the language. That language is Arabic.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>It is summer in Israel, so someone must be either protesting or on strike. This time protests were started by only a small, extremely anti-Zionist sect within the Haredi community, the <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Edah_HaChareidis">Eda HaHaredit</a>, over <a href="http://occidentalisraeli.com/2009/05/20/oren-existential-threats-jerusalem/">Jerusalem</a> Mayor <a href="http://occidentalisraeli.com/2008/11/12/jerusalem-has-a-future-again/">Nir Barkat&#8217;s</a> decision to <a href="http://www.google.com/hostednews/afp/article/ALeqM5jpoTMNJCoMfoK6KsfH9UJ8VUZ17A">open a parking lot for use</a> on Shabbat. The parking lot would be operated by a non-Jew, and would help alleviate the city&#8217;s parking shortage. That was a few weeks ago. In the mean time, much of the larger Haredi community has taken on this &#8220;cause&#8221; as their own.</p>
<p>These protests are not peaceful demonstrations, but <a href="http://www.haaretz.com/hasen/spages/1096201.html">violent riots</a>, and often take place on Shabbat, in violation Jewish law. Not only do the rioters ignore the concept of ואהבת לרעך כמוך (love your friend as yourself) by attacking people, throwing rocks is a violation of Shabbat. These rioters, and those who incite them are merely <a href="http://occidentalisraeli.com/2008/09/24/parasites/">masquerading</a> as observant Jews.</p>
<p>A few weeks ago, (former) Ha&#8217;aretz reporter Shachar Ilan <a href="http://cafe.themarker.com/view.php?t=1071438">wrote in his <em>The Marker</em> blog</a> about the situation:</p>
<blockquote><p><strong>To embarrass!</strong> That is the name of the game in the new Shabbat struggle in Jerusalem. The Eda HaHaredit (a small fanatical faction) opposes the participation of the Haredi parties in the municipal coalition and so they protest. In the intra-Haredi political game the Eda HaHaredit is the opposition and the Haredi parties are the government. The opposition&#8217;s job is to criticize. The fact that the Safra Parking Lot is surrounded by restaurants, pubs and clubs that have been operating on Shabbat for years is irrelevant. As is the fact that the parking lot will not charge for parking, or that parking at Safra will prevent parking on Shivtei Yisrael Road near Mea Shearim, and will prevent serious safety hazards. The issue is the opening of the parking lot on Shabbat, and the Eda HaHaredit will not miss a golden opportunity to embarrass the Haredi parties.</p>
<p>&#8230;</p>
<p><strong>The economic angle.</strong> There is a difficult crisis in donations to religious institutions due to the global economic crisis. The Eda HaHaredit subsists primarily on donations. It is a well-known secret that religious struggles and confrontations with the Zionist police encourage donations. Could it be that the new Shabbat struggle in Jerusalem is part of the fallout from the global economic crisis and that the reporting of the Shabbat protests should be done in the business section? Can&#8217;t be. No way. How could one suspect the Torah sages of such motives?</p></blockquote>
<p>Ilan&#8217;s analysis is interesting, but the comments section is fascinating. A former Haredi,  Shlomo, shares his insight into the world of the young protesters. This perspective is rare to see, as airing dirty laundry is taboo. Teenagers were assigned to various locations for the protests, and participants were exempt from homework. In his words, they were but &#8220;mere cannon fodder.&#8221; When they threw stones, they thought about the punishment Shabbat violators will receive in hell. When they burned Israeli flags on Yom Ha&#8217;atzmaut, they thought about how the state is impeding the arrival of the Messiah. Vandalism or respect for property &#8211; &#8220;these were not terms that were in our lexicon.&#8221; These crimes are encouraged, and those who commit them are idolized:</p>
<blockquote><p>Each of us that was arrested, turned into the darling of the class, or the Yeshiva, surrounded by love in shul, got calls of &#8220;yishar koach&#8221; from passersby, even though we only spent a few hours in the Russian Compound (police headquarters).</p></blockquote>
<p>In addition to the brainwashing of these kids to commit crimes, the hypocrisy of the rioters is clear. On the one hand, they are anti-Zionist, disavowing Jewish sovereignty until the coming of the Messiah. On the other hand, their behavior exhibits their sense of entitlement in the Zionist state.</p>
<p>An old story (source unknown) about Rabbi Shach emphasizes this point. Upon witnessing a Haredi man yelling at an Israel Police officer, Rabbi Shach quipped that the man must have become a Zionist. The man was surprised, &#8220;What are you talking about?&#8221; Rabbi Shach responded, &#8220;Would you have dared to yell at a police officer back in Poland?&#8221; In other words, is there rioting in the streets of Brooklyn and Antwerp?</p>
